Job 29:7
When I went out to the gate through the city, when I prepared my seat in the street!
--------------------
Job 29:8
The young men saw me, and hid themselves: and the aged arose, and stood up.
Job 29:9
The princes refrained talking, and laid their hand on their mouth.
Job 29:10
The nobles held their peace, and their tongue cleaved to the roof of their mouth.
Job 29:11
When the ear heard me, then it blessed me; and when the eye saw me, it gave witness to me:
Job 29:12
Because I delivered the poor that cried, and the fatherless, and him that had none to help him.
Job 29:13
The blessing of him that was ready to perish came upon me: and I caused the widow's heart to sing for joy.
Job 29:14
I put on righteousness, and it clothed me: my judgment was as a robe and a diadem.
Job 29:15
I was eyes to the blind, and feet was I to the lame.
Job 29:16
I was a father to the poor: and the cause which I knew not I searched out.
Job 29:17
And I brake the jaws of the wicked, and plucked the spoil out of his teeth.
Job 29:18
Then I said, I shall die in my nest, and I shall multiply my days as the sand.
Job 29:19
My root was spread out by the waters, and the dew lay all night upon my branch.
Job 29:20
My glory was fresh in me, and my bow was renewed in my hand.
Job 29:21
Unto me men gave ear, and waited, and kept silence at my counsel.
Job 29:22
After my words they spake not again; and my speech dropped upon them.
